GIRLS OF SUMMER

The Girls of Summer Softball League is an effort which began in 2000 to create a sports program specifically aimed at girls entering grades 4-6 in the Milwaukee area. The league is designed to introduce girls enrolled in the MPS Recreation Department's Summer Wrap-Around Recreation Program and the Summer Recreation Enrichment Camps to the game of softball.

The league was designed to emphasize success, participation and skill development rather than competition, and provides a vehicle to introduce girls to the game of softball at a younger age as many girls in Milwaukee are not exposed to softball until they are in high school. The benefits of the league are far reaching. Participants learn new skills, increase self-confidence, develop leadership and team building skills, make new friends and have fun. Over 200 girls have participated in the league each summer since its inception.

The collaborative nature of the league is what has made its implementation possible. Milwaukee Recreation and the Girl Scouts of the Greater Milwaukee Area Inc., have teamed up with the Milwaukee Brewers to support the Girls of Summer.
